Introduction

Interpretation of the core content of the standard

As an important technical specification in the field of judicial identification of environmental damage, this standard mainly solves professional and technical problems in cases of destruction of cultivated land and forest land. Its technical framework includes three core modules:

ModuleTechnical requirementsLegal basis
Entrustment acceptance 7 types of basic materials + qualification review are required Ministry of Justice Order No. 107
Identification procedure 4-stage working method + 5 sampling schemes HJ/T 166+NY/T 395
Opinion formation 5 types of severe damage judgment standards GB 15618+GB 36600

Analysis of key technical points

1. Special requirements for on-site investigation

The standard requires that more than two judicial appraisers jointly conduct the investigation, and three parties must witness it (the client + the party concerned). The investigation must cover 7 types of key information sources, including historical archives verification of the land administration department and on-site interviews with local people.

2. Innovative sampling point distribution method

Differentiated schemes are adopted for different types of damage:

  • Physical damage:Zigzag/plum blossom-shaped distribution, ≥3 sampling points in a unit
  • Pollution damage:Establish a three-dimensional pollution plume model according to HJ 25.1
  • Biological damage:A customized ecosystem damage assessment scheme is required

Suggestions for the implementation of the standard

1. Capacity building of appraisal institutions

It is recommended to establish a four-dimensional capability matrix:

  1. Surveying and mapping qualification (at least Class C)
  2. CMA certification and testing items cover all indicators of GB 15618
  3. GIS spatial analysis system
  4. Professional team for ecological risk assessment

2. : Key points for building a chain of evidence

A three-in-one evidence package should be formed:

  • Spatial evidence: remote sensing images + on-site mapping data
  • Material evidence: soil profile specimens + laboratory test reports
  • Related evidence: land use historical archives + witness testimony

Typical case analysis

Case: Identification of forest damage caused by illegal mining

A mining area violated the Forest Law and mined, resulting in the complete stripping of the topsoil of 12 acres of ecological public welfare forest. Identification agency:

  1. Using UAV oblique photography to build a three-dimensional model
  2. Six profile samples were collected using the plum blossom pattern method
  3. Soil organic matter content was tested to be less than 0.5% (control point 3.2%)
  4. The destruction was determined by citing the judicial interpretation of forest land by the Supreme People's Court
